Description

Butoconazole is an imidazole derivative that exhibits antifungal/antimycotic and anti-parasitic activities; it likely inhibits 14-α demethylase. Butoconazole displays particularly effective antimicrobial activity against species of Candida, Saccharomyces, and Trichomonas.

Product Info

Cas No.

64872-77-1

Purity

≥98%

Formula

C19H17Cl3N2S • HNO3

Formula Wt.

474.79

Chemical Name

1-[4-(4-chlorophenyl)-2-(2,6-dichlorophenyl)sulfanylbutyl]imidazole;nitric acid

IUPAC Name

1-[4-(4-chlorophenyl)-2-(2, 6-dichlorophenyl)sulfanylbutyl]imidazole;nitric acid

Synonym

Femstat, Gynomyk, Gynazole-1

Melting Point

159°C (dec.)

Appearance

White to off white powder
